Income Tax Rates 2011 - 2012

The 2011 Income Tax Rates are the tax rates paid on each tax bracket which is based on your annual income. Your actual tax rate is a variable percentage since each portion of your income is taxed at the tax bracket rate that it falls into. As your income increases into another tax bracket, that portion of income is taxed at the higher rate. 2012 income tax rates are scheduled to stay the same.
